Ashtabula- Agnes Rose Cook, 92, passed away peacefully on Friday, February 12, 2021 at the Cleveland Clinic. She was born on January 3, 1929 in Johnstown, Pennsylvania the daughter of Thomas and Mary (Kavalecz) Toth. Agnes graduated from the Windber High School Class of 1947. She was employed as a cashier at Alber's before marrying the love of her life, Harold E. Cook on September 6, 1948 and would start a wonderful family. Agnes was a member of Our Lady of Peace Parish. She enjoyed collecting Fenton Glass, traveling and antiques. She is survived by her children, Harold (Cindy) Cook, David (Charlene) Cook and Roger (Tammy) Cook; grandchildren, David, Tracy, Laura, Brian, Amy, Adam and Ryan; great-grandchildren, Phoebe, Abigail, Gabriel, Mason, Allie, and Rhett; and her brother, George. She was preceded in death by her parents; beloved husband, Harold Cook in 2009; and her siblings, Pearl, Frank, Marishka, Joseph, Helen, Mary, Frank, Steve and Irene.
